Game ‍Dynamics ‌and Player‌ Experience in Online Blackjack

Game ​Dynamics and Player ⁢Experience in Online ⁢Blackjack

The experience of playing ⁤blackjack online is markedly different⁤ from​ that of a‌ traditional land-based casino, primarily ⁤due to the dynamics of game interaction and⁤ player⁤ immersion. In‌ an online⁤ setting, players⁤ engage with⁢ advanced ​software that uses random number generators to‌ emulate the unpredictable‌ nature‌ of deck shuffling and card dealing, creating an experience that truly mirrors the randomness of physical gameplay. ‌Notably, the user ‌interface plays a crucial role‍ in‍ enhancing player experience, with ‌features ‍such as customizable settings,⁣ sound effects, and animations‍ that bring ⁣the game to life. Here,⁢ players ​can enjoy features ⁤such ‍as:

  • Convenience: Play from anywhere, at any ⁣time.
  • Variety: ⁣Access to‌ multiple ​game variations and betting options.
  • Accessibility: No ⁤need to⁢ wait for a seat at the ‌table.
  • Bonuses: ⁢Exclusive online promotions that boost bankrolls.

In contrast, land-based casinos offer ‍a unique atmosphere that can ​enhance the social‌ interaction and emotional⁤ engagement associated‌ with⁢ the game. Players often thrive on the energy of the physical space,⁣ enjoying ​the camaraderie among fellow players and the excitement ‌of live dealer interactions. The tactile⁢ feel of​ handling real cards and chips can create a sense ‌of authenticity that some players cherish. Consider ‍the following key aspects:

Aspect Online Blackjack Land-Based Blackjack
Atmosphere Virtual,⁤ customizable Physical, energetic
Social Interaction Limited,‌ often solitary Rich, face-to-face
Realism Digital simulation Authentic experience
Game Speed Variable⁣ based on software Real-time pace

Strategy and ‍Skill: Navigating Blackjack Rules ⁢Across Platforms

Strategy⁤ and Skill: Navigating Blackjack Rules Across Platforms

Mastering ⁢blackjack is as much about strategy as ⁢it is about understanding the ‌nuances of the game across different platforms. ‌When playing online, players often encounter variations that might not be present in traditional land-based casinos. Virtual blackjack can ⁢offer features‍ like multi-hand play and side​ bets that aren’t typically available at⁣ physical tables.‍ In addition, players can ‍indulge in live⁢ dealer games, which simulate the ‌real casino experience while allowing for‍ convenience and ⁤accessibility from home.‌ Understanding the specific rules⁢ and ⁤betting options from platform to ‌platform ⁢is crucial for maximizing​ your potential winnings.

Aside⁤ from gameplay variations, the rules regarding table limits and player options can significantly differ. In land-based casinos, players may face more rigid betting limits due to ⁤the fixed nature of physical spaces. Conversely, online platforms ⁣often provide a wider​ range of options, accommodating both high rollers and‍ casual players. Here’s a quick comparison table⁤ showcasing key aspects:

Platform Table Limits Gameplay Features Player Interaction
Land-Based Casinos Generally higher Standard rules Limited
Online ‌Casinos Flexible options Side bets, multi-hand Chat features available

By recognizing these strategic ⁤differences, players can tailor their approach to blackjack based on where they choose to play. ‌ Experimentation with various platforms can also lead to a⁣ better understanding​ of⁢ which rules and​ styles resonate ⁤most, enhancing‌ the overall⁤ gaming ​experience.

Banking⁤ Options and​ Promotions: Maximizing Your Gameplay Value

Banking ​Options and Promotions: Maximizing Your Gameplay Value

When exploring⁤ the world of⁣ blackjack, both online and land-based settings offer various banking options that⁢ can significantly influence your gameplay experience. Online‌ casinos ⁤typically provide a wider‌ range of deposit and withdrawal methods, ‌including credit cards, e-wallets, and cryptocurrencies.⁢ This flexibility allows players ‌to choose what⁢ suits them⁤ best, ensuring seamless ‍transactions. ‍In contrast, ‍traditional casinos often limit⁤ options‌ to cash or credit cards, which can be ⁢less‌ convenient for ​those who prefer digital transactions.⁢ Therefore, understanding the ⁣available banking choices can enhance your ⁢gaming experience by allowing for quicker access to funds⁣ and more efficient⁢ handling of your bankroll.

Furthermore, promotions play a pivotal‍ role in​ maximizing the value you derive from‌ your gameplay. Online platforms frequently offer bonuses ⁤like welcome packages,‍ reload bonuses, and loyalty rewards that can provide ​players with additional⁤ funds to extend ⁢their ⁣playtime. These promotions ⁣often ​come⁣ with specific wagering requirements that ‌can vary ‌significantly between casinos. In ⁤land-based establishments, while the bonuses may not be as prolific, players can ⁣enjoy exclusive promotions,‍ such as VIP nights or complementary drinks ⁢and meals, which⁣ can enhance the ‌overall ‌experience. Understanding ⁣these promotional offers, whether online or offline, is crucial ⁤for savvy players eager to optimize⁢ their blackjack strategy ‌and bankroll management.
